Address 0 PPC

P8x79FZX4pzfu5bSnBd6Zggzvf6CYXpTuD

Confirmed

Total Received11.456614 PPC
Total Sent11.456614 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PHEJeY3Kx8zHPB9iQXdkExUeVYeZBjDDJF40.31 PPC
P8x79FZX4pzfu5bSnBd6Zggzvf6CYXpTuD11.456614 PPC
Fee: 0.01 PPC
391087 Confirmations51.756614 PPC
P8x79FZX4pzfu5bSnBd6Zggzvf6CYXpTuD11.456614 PPC
PEzhiL2hsfPeteMZVteNnV4FHaP8VzUKxF27.564266 PPC
Fee: 0.01 PPC
391092 Confirmations39.02088 PPC